How to prepare for a job interview at Greene King
✨Know Your Pub Inside Out
Before the interview, make sure you research the pub's history, menu, and customer reviews. This will not only show your genuine interest but also help you discuss how you can enhance the customer experience.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Style
Prepare examples of how you've successfully led a team in the past. Think about specific challenges you faced and how you motivated your team to overcome them. This will demonstrate your strong leadership skills.
✨Be Ready to Discuss Sales Growth
Think of innovative strategies you've implemented in previous roles to boost sales. Be prepared to share these ideas during the interview, as the company is looking for someone who can grow their pub sales effectively.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are thoughtful questions about the company's culture, team dynamics, and future goals. This shows that you're not just interested in the role, but also in how you can contribute to the company's success.
